Delhi University says No application filed by Lenskart Co‑Founder!

    Share on

As eyewear firm Lenskart prepares for its IPO, dropout disclosures in its Draft Red Herring Prospectus (DRHP) revealed that co-founder Sumeet Kapahi cannot locate his B.Com (Hons) degree and marksheets from Delhi University. Kapahi claimed to have sent multiple emails and applied through the university’s online portal requesting duplicate copies, but received no response.

Responding publicly, Delhi University (DU) said it had received no formal application or email from Kapahi, though there was a payment made by someone named Deepesh requesting a duplicate marksheet on behalf of Kapahi. DU has advised him to submit a proper application via its portal and complete the fee procedure .

Lenskart disclosed the missing documents as a risk factor in the IPO, citing uncertainty over whether the university will ever provide the credentials. Until then, the company will rely on certificates furnished by Kapahi and the lead managers for verification purposes.
